Web the radiation pattern is defined as a mathematical function or a graphical representation of the far field (ie, for r ≫ 2 d2 / λ, with d being the largest dimension of the antenna) radiation properties of the antenna, as a function of the direction of departure of the electromagnetic (em) wave.
